What to Expect During Garbage Disposal Installation

When you engage professional plumbing services for garbage disposal installation in Plant City, you can anticipate a thorough and professional process. Local plumbers are well-acquainted with the various plumbing systems and building codes prevalent in the area, ensuring the installation is compliant and effective. The process typically involves several key steps:

  • Assessment of Existing Plumbing: The plumber will first inspect your current sink and plumbing configuration to determine compatibility and any necessary modifications. This includes checking the drain line size and the electrical outlet availability for the disposal unit.
  • Removal of Old Unit (if applicable): If you are replacing an existing garbage disposal, the technician will safely disconnect and remove the old unit.
  • Mounting the New Disposal: The new unit will be securely mounted to the sink drain flange. This often involves a plumber’s putty or sealant to create a watertight seal.
  • Connecting the Drain Line: The disposal unit’s discharge pipe will be connected to your existing drain system. For dual-basin sinks, a special Y-connector or plumbing elbow is often used to divert waste from both sides.
  • Electrical Connection: For plug-in models, the plumber will ensure a safe and accessible outlet is available. For hardwired units, they will safely connect the disposal to your home’s electrical system, adhering to all safety standards.
  • Testing and Inspection: After installation, the plumber will run water and test the disposal to ensure it functions correctly, there are no leaks, and the unit operates smoothly.

The materials commonly used include durable plumbing connectors, plumber’s putty for sealing, and electrical wiring and connectors where necessary. What are the key differences between a plug-in and a hardwired garbage disposal installation?

A plug-in garbage disposal connects to a standard electrical outlet under the sink, making installation simpler and often allowing for easier replacement. A hardwired garbage disposal, on the other hand, is directly connected to your home’s electrical wiring. This typically requires a dedicated circuit and should always be installed by a qualified plumber or electrician to ensure safety and code compliance.
